• Breakfast & Lunch Options in the Summer: Please remember that District 77 offers a free breakfast and lunch at many of its buildings over the summer. This summer, the meal program will NOT be offered at Roosevelt. West High School and Jefferson Elementary are the closest sites that will be open. Breakfast is served from 7:30-8:30 AM, while lunch is offered from 11:00-12:30 PM. Other sites that offer free meals include: East High School, Hoover, Rosa Parks, Franklin, Monroe & Kennedy.
